3D Photo Browser for Digital Camera - 3D Photo Browser for Digital Camera (x32/x64 bits) is a must for viewing, editing and organizing
your image, video and audio files.
It displays high quality thumbnails in a
comfortable customizable window. You see your whole photos library thanks to the multi-folders
view. It recognizes more than 80 image formats, supports automatic rotation for digital camera
images and allows browing in ZIP without decompressing them.
You can describe each
file using the keywords and information panel then export/import to/from a database or make
advanced search based EXIF or keywords critirias.
The image viewer includes a wide
range of tools (rotate, crop, resize, filters...), slides show, conversion and printing
features.
Batch command feature allows applying a set of commands to a set of files.
For example, you can - in a single step - resize, rotate, then convert to 128 colors a set of
images.
The screen capture tool is one of the most powerful of the market: if offers
still image or movie capture from a window or a defined area, magnifier to assist with
pixel-by-pixel cropping, capture preview, application live-state mode enable you to communicate
visually with your entourage.
Nothing is more simple that printing a contact sheet of
a directory content. You control accurately page setup (fonts, colors...) and can add information
under each image using tags feature. Once your settings done, you can save them in the template
library.
Export your images to the web using the HTML format. Select the HTML template
that fits your needs and let 3D Photo Browser for Digital Camera do the job for you.
